Transaction 61a37b6135fcbed6a8d352a0663e25b1514b7659c3dd6d913b99305c46928bc0

5 Input
2 Outputs
  • 61a37b6135fcbed6a8d352a0663e25b1514b7659c3dd6d913b99305c46928bc0:0
  • value  21110539
    address  16GXVKrR3Y5RPdcjdmhZxakj3DHg9HhBgS
  • 61a37b6135fcbed6a8d352a0663e25b1514b7659c3dd6d913b99305c46928bc0:1
  • value  4288107
    address  3BMEXg7R64VFMEiSVZg1iBeu79rRVnRJkk